RESEARCH AREAS:

Laser diagnostics of plasmas, infrared and far infrared lasers, laser stabilisation and frequency control, nonlinear optics,chaos in lasers , pattern formation in lasers, optical phase singularities, optical particle trapping, atom trapping, multiphoton fluorescence imaging, spectroscopy of quantum dots.
